A Stellar Mystery Unveiled
Astronomers have stumbled upon an exciting cosmic conundrum in the nearby galaxy NGC 4945. Named 'Punctum,' this astonishing object, only detectable in millimeter radio wavelengths, defies all existing astrophysical categories, revealing the universe's ongoing mysteries.
Who Discovered Punctum?
The discovery of Punctum comes from a dedicated team led by Elena Shablovinskaia at the Instituto de Estudios Astrofísicos in Chile. Using the advanced Atacama Large Millimeter/submillimeter Array (ALMA), the team unveiled this powerful object, marking a breakthrough in astronomical observation.
The Power of Punctum
Shablovinskaia describes Punctum as astonishingly bright—up to 100,000 times more luminous than typical magnetars and competing with some of the brightest supernovae known to humanity. This intense brightness suggests it radiates energy like nothing we’ve encountered before, capturing the attention of scientists worldwide.
What Is Punctum?
While its exact nature remains elusive, Punctum exhibits unique characteristics. Observations from 2023 confirm that its brightness remains stable, ruling out transitory flare phenomena. Astronomers theorize that it might be producing synchrotron radiation, a phenomenon arising when high-energy particles spiral around magnetic fields. This suggests that Punctum harbors a highly structured magnetic field, making it a captivating subject for further study.
The Great Debate: Magnetar or Something Else?
One hypothesis is that Punctum might be powered by a magnetar, a type of highly magnetic pulsar. However, the massive luminosity of Punctum exceeds that of known magnetars at millimeter wavelengths, leaving astronomers debating its classification. Could it be a unique variant or an entirely new category of astronomical object?
Why Is Punctum So Special?
Unlike typical supernova remnants, which are large and diffuse, Punctum is genuinely compact. Astonishingly, it sits just 11 million light-years away from us, beyond our Milky Way but still considered a close neighbor in the cosmic realm.
Future Investigations Ahead
With the James Webb Space Telescope poised to investigate further, there’s hope that a clearer understanding of Punctum may soon emerge. The JWST's enhanced resolution could decipher whether its emissions are purely synchrotron or influenced by other cosmic elements, opening the door to new discoveries.
